The module arranges the basics and shows the procedure in the following steps by means of a detailed example. Click plc instruction set ladder symbol title type description normally open contact bit instruction the normally open contact mimics the behavior of a physical contact and changes in response to the. Ladder logic lad for s7 300 and s7400 programming reference manual, 042017, a5e41524738aa 3 preface purpose this manual is your guide to creating user programs in the statement list. Mitsubishi plc programming tutorials howto program. Select a plc type in the selection box, select ladder as the programming language. This is a very basic example about the inputs and outputs of a plc. If you need a more thorough understanding of basic plc concepts, you might want to try the beginners guide to plc programming how to program a plc programmable logic controller. Lecture plc programming basics mme 486 fall 2006 4 of 62 processor memory organization advanced ladder logic functions allow controllers to perform calculations, make decisions and do other complex tasks. They are called ladder diagrams because they resemble a ladder, with two vertical rails supply power and as many rungs horizontal lines as there are control circuits to represent.
Plc program examples plc logics examples ladder logic. Turn the key on the plc to the rem middle position. An instruction that takes some action, such as turn on. Study the ondelay timer ladder logic program in figure 735, and from each of the conditions stated. Programmable logic control plc supplemental material. Plc ladder logic programming examples the plc ladder logic programming examples that i am about to share with you guys will really help you in developing complex ladder logic. In this module, the reader will learn about the programming of a programmable logic controller plc with the programming tool step 7. Ladder logic flowchart programming differences and examples this document is designed as a quickstart primer to assist industrial automation programmers who are familiar with. This file shows how the square root of a value between 1 and 9999 could be calculated. Plc memory ladder logic program runs output image plc memory state of actual output device as the ladder logic program is scanned, it reads the input data table then writes to a portion of plc memory the output data, table as it executes the output data table is copied to the actual output devices after the ladder logic has been scanned. All diagrams and examples in this manual are for illustrative purposes only. In no way does including these diagrams and examples in this manual constitute a guarantee as to their suitability for any. The format used is similar to that of the hardwired. Advanced ladder logic functions allow controllers to.
Timers and counters are examples of ladder logic functions. Use the programmable logic controller to make a control circuit using two normally open. Rslogix 500 getting results guide rockwell automation. Normally closed contact is on when normally closed. Plc ladder logic programming examples with detailed. Another brand specific issue is the names for the instructions and functions. Programmable logic controllers plcs permit hardware control devices such as relays, timers, counters, and drum controllers sequencers to be replaced by programmable solidstate components and programmed instructions. Installation of software and the modification of a program interface. We consider the example ladder logic file in rslogix of figure 2. Originally plcs were designed to replace relay control logic. Plc ladder logic programming examples the plc ladder logic programming examples that i am about to share with you guys will really help you in developing complex ladder logic diagrams. Ethernetbased communication setup and msg instruction use. An instruction that checks, compares, or examines specific conditions in your machine or process. Automation builder includes the plc programming software control builder plus.
For the most part, programming the slc500 series of plc processors is identical to programming the plc 5 processors. Note that with the ladder diagram we tell the plc when it has reached the end of the program by the use of the end or ret instruction, plc example 2. The first thing you naturally would do, is to think about it for yourself. The plc ladder logic programming is really easy as compared to the arduino or any other microcontroller programming. If in doubt at any stage of the installation of the plc always. Programming examples 52 programming examples examples using plcdirect plcs the opwinedit configuration software allows you to configure a panel to use a block of registers at a starting value. The function block diagram and the ladder diagram are thus of the form shown in figure 1. The codesys training material made from the text in the online help of codesys programming tool version 3. Plc ladder logic programming examples the plc ladder logic. Power up the computer, plc rack, and external power supply.
Simple program that adjusts the plc clock to account for daylight saving time. The codesys training material made from the text in the online help of codesys. Allen bradley offers as a free download a software package called rslogix micro starter lite which is essentially the same programming environment as rslogix 500. The normally open contact is on when the related bit is on. The third problem that authors have failed to address is the variety of programming languages available. They are more complex than basic inputs contacts and output coils and rely. They are called ladder diagrams because they resemble a. The new control system had to meet the following requirements. Qseries basic coursefor gx developer mitsubishi programmable logic controller training manual qseries basic coursefor gx developer qseries basic coursefor gx developer mitsubishi programmable logic controller. The examples described in this document are intended for learning purposes only. Programmable logic controllers plcs permit hardware control devices such as relays, timers, counters, and drum controllers sequencers to be replaced by programmable solidstate components and.
This guide does not cover technical details regarding the setting of the fa system or plc programming after purchase. This document and its related zelio soft 2 project files. How to convert plc ladder diagram into pdf file youtube. Jun 27, 2015 many plc ladder logic program examples are available for download, and you will have to install the plc programming software to view the example ladder. The manual also includes a reference section that describes the syntax and functions of the language elements of ladder logic. Click on the fbd icon then on next to program in fbd. Click plc instruction set ladder symbol title type description normally open contact bit instruction the normally open contact mimics the behavior of a physical contact and changes in response to the status of a bit memory address. The module arranges the basics and shows the procedure in the. The beginners guide to plc programming works well in conjunction with this book, in that it concentrates on basic plc programming methods that are common to all types of plcs. This is a means of writing programs which can then be converted into machine code by some software for use by the plc microprocessor. Configuring allen bradley rslinx and rslogix for use with the plc trainer. An analysis of the ladder program files that results in the display of any.
Many plc ladder logic program examples are available for download, and you will have to install the plc programming software to view the example ladder. A log records operations, user actions and internal processes during an online session in a. Ladder logic lad for s7300 and s7400 programming reference manual, 052010, a5e0279007901 5 online help the manual is complemented by an online help which is integrated in the software. Abb automation builder covers the engineering of abb plcs, safety plcs, control panels, drives and motion. Programming examples 52 programming examples examples using plcdirect plcs the opwinedit configuration software allows you to configure a panel to use a block of registers at a starting value that you define. Study the ondelay timer ladder logic program in figure 735, and from each of the conditions stated, determine whether the timer is reset, timing, or timed out or if the conditions stated are not possible.
Ladder logic examples or examples of plc programs is a great way to. Pdf beginners guide to plc programming how to program a. Lets say you have a specific functionality, you want to implement in your ladder logic, a plc timer function for example. To do so, a ladder program, consisting of a set of instructions representing the logic to be. These steps are programmed into the plc using a ladder logic program, which consists of a specific.
Its format is similar to the electrical style of drawing known as the ladder diagram. Before attempting to install or use the plc this manual should be read and understood. Plc io module types and and plc trainer configuration. Ladder diagram example a manual mixing operation is to be automated using sequential process control methods. This chapter is an introduction to the programming of a plc using ladder. Can be used in dl250, 350, 450 and dl05 if the optional memory cartridge is installed. This ebook, along with the online tutorial, provides an example of how to automate a drill press, while explaining all the basic concepts of plc programming.
In addition, it provides an example of machine operation, whereas plc programming with rslogix 500 uses the example of a chemical batching process. Use the programmable logic controller to make a control circuit using two normally open no switches, to control the feed to a coil through the switches sw1, sw2 as in the following circuit figure, we. A log records operations, user actions and internal processes during an. Plc memory ladder logic program runs output image plc memory state of actual output device as the ladder logic program is scanned, it reads the input data table then writes to a portion of plc. Plc ladder logic programming examples with detailed explanation engr fahad september 27, 2019 add comment description. Another reason to make use of ladder logic examples is, that you can learn from them. A on top of that, they also offer rslogix emulate for free so that you donat even need a plc to run and test your ladder logic. Introduction to programmable logic controllers plcs. Determine if there are special functions in the process 4.
For the most part, programming the slc500 series of plc processors is identical to. On its own, however it is unsuitable for complex programs. For a dl105, dl205, d3350 or dl405 cpu the recommended memory to use is the general purpose data words starting at v2000. Note that with the ladder diagram we tell the plc when it has reached the end of the program by the use of the. This video is an introduction to what ladder logic is and how it works. In small and micro plc systems, the power supply is also used to power field devices. Nov 15, 2018 after making any plc projects, we have to take print or pdf file for machine drawing or other references so please watch and understand how to convert plc ladder into pdf or other files. Lecture plc programming basics mme 486 fall 2006 4 of 62 processor memory organization advanced ladder logic functions allow controllers to perform calculations, make decisions and do. Estimate program capacity depending on the process 5. Rung a section of the plc ladder program that terminates in an output. Automationdirect technical support example programs. They must not be used directly on products that are part of a machine or process.
After making any plc projects, we have to take print or pdf file for machine drawing or other references so please watch and understand how to convert plc ladder into pdf or other files. Ladder logic ladder diagrams ladder diagrams are specialized schematics commonly used to document industrial control logic systems. Training document for the companywide automation solution. Logix 5000 controllers ladder diagram programming manual. In large plc systems, this power supply does not normally supply power to the field devices. Plc memory ladder logic program runs output image plc memory state of actual output device as the ladder logic program is scanned, it reads the input data table then writes to a portion of plc memory the. Put a value in memory location vw200, and using shifting method, move this value to the output of the plc.
As another example, consider a valve which is to be operated to lift a load when a pump is running and. In large plc systems, this power supply does not normally supply. Plc ladder logic programming examples with detailed explanation. This online help is intended to provide you with detailed support when using the software. Ladder logic flowchart programming differences and examples this document is designed as a quickstart primer to assist industrial automation programmers who are familiar with plcs and relay ladder logic programming to better understand the corresponding principles and techniques for constructing optocontrol programs. As a consequence, ladder programming was developed. Data handling and program control flow instructions. Sep 27, 2019 plc ladder logic programming examples the plc ladder logic programming examples that i am about to share with you guys will really help you in developing complex ladder logic diagrams. Write a ladder logic program that wili turn on a light, pl, 15 s after switch sl has been turned on. Programmable logic controllers, basic level textbook. Ladder language is selected by default yellow outline, click on next to program in ladder. Plc programming with rslogix 500 engineer and technician. Lecture introduction to plcs mme 486 fall 2006 19 of 47 power supply supplies dc power to other modules that plug into the rack.